UTS Australian Football Club members has elected a new committee and new president for the 2022 AFL Sydney season.
Adrian Sibbick has been elected to the presidency, after Megan Gigacz retired from the position at the club’s recent annual general meeting.
Megan will continue as the club secretary for the 2022 season.
Sam Chadwick (football portfolio) and Rose Leeson-Smith (social media portfolio) will be the club’s two vice-presidents for 2022.
They will be joined by Tom Gosper (Treasurer), Kai Mehta (UTS Partnership), Matt Agius (Media, Communications and Data), Daniel Cassarotto (Canteen and Merchandise), Chris Jepsen (Facilities and Match Day), Katie McCaffery (Events) and Liam O’Neil, Damien Menzies and Mitchell Sciberras (General Committee Members).
The Bats thank our 2021 board members and new 2022 board for giving their time to provide leadership for the club.
Adrian Sibbick is the owner and director of club partner Accounting Evolution, and is a former player, coach, volunteer and committee member for the club.
Special motions, including the ratification of a new constitution enabling the club to become incorporated were also passed at the annual general meeting.
